Understanding UK Gambling Licences and Their Importance

When evaluating an online casino’s trustworthiness, the first and most critical factor is its licensing status. In the UK, the only when legitimate regulatory body is the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), which enforces some of the strictest standards in the industry. A UKGC licence ensures that the casino operates under stringent rules regarding player protection, fair gaming, and anti-money laundering measures. Before signing up, ever verify the licence number on the UKGC website and check the operator’s terms for clarity on dispute declaration. Casinos without a UKGC licence or those holding offshore permits same Malta or Curacao should be approached with extreme caution, as they do not offer the same level of regulatory oversight or financial safeguards for UK players. The presence of a valid UKGC licence is your primary feather assurance that the casino adheres to sound requirements and can be held accountable for any misconduct. For instance, the UKGC mandates that all operators must chip in to GambleAware and participate in the self-exclusion scheme GAMSTOP, providing additional layers of protection. Furthermore, licensed casinos are subject to regular audits and must state elaborate reports on their financial health, ensuring they can pay out winnings. In direct contrast, offshore licences often lack such rigorous oversight, leaving players vulnerable to unfair practices or even outright fraud. Therefore, always prioritise UKGC-licensed casinos and double-check the licence details on the official register to avoid rogue operators that power display fake credentials.

Assessing Security Measures and Data Protection

Security measures is paramount when choosing an online casino, as you will be sharing sensitive personal and financial information. Top-tier UK casinos employ advanced SSL encryption (128-fleck or 256-bit) to protect data during transmission, and they should clearly display their surety protocols in their privacy insurance policy. Look for casinos that have been independently audited by organisations like eCOGRA or iTech Labs, which verify the fairness of games and the integrity of random number generators. Additionally, reputable operators offer two-factor authentication (2FA) for account logins and withdrawals, adding an extra layer of protection. Check whether the casino has a robust data protection policy that complies with UK GDPR regulations. If a site lacks clear security information or uses obsolete encryption, it is not worth risking your money or identity. For instance, a trustworthy casino will explicitly state its encryption standards and may even display security badges from trusted vendors.

The Cornerstones of Trustworthy Licensing and Security

When Canadian players begin their search for a reputable online casino, the very first-class honours degree element they must scrutinise is the licensing and surety framework. In Canada, there is no federal gambling regulator; instead, provinces and territories care their own regimes, and many reputable online casinos serving Canadian players hold licences from the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) for the province of Ontario, or from the Kahnawake Gaming Commission (KGC) for operations based in the Mohawk Territory of Kahnawake. These bodies enforce rigorous standards for player protection, game fairness, and financial transparence. A licence from the AGCO or the KGC signals that the casino has undergone thorough background checks and must adhere to strict codes of conduct. For instance, AGCO licensees are required to participate in the province’s iGaming market, which mandates responsible gambling tools like PlaySmart, while KGC licensees must comply with its Technical Standards for gaming systems, which ensure random outcomes and data integrity. Beyond the licence itself, security measures are paramount. Every trustworthy casino should employ 128-chip or 256-bit SSL encryption to protect all data transfers between the player and the land site. This encryption ensures that personal details such as names, addresses, and banking information remain inaccessible to unauthorised parties. Additionally, hunt for casinos that have their games and random number generators (RNGs) audited by independent third-party testing agencies the like eCOGRA, iTech Labs, or GLI (Gaming Laboratories International). An audit certificate or seal on the website indicates that the games are really random and that the stated return-to-player percentages are accurate. Many players overlook these details, but they are the bedrock of a safe gambling environment. A casino that cannot clearly display its licence number, encryption details, and audit certifications should be viewed with great suspicion. Furthermore, responsible gambling tools such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ks are also hallmarks of a licensed and ethical operator. For example, Ontario-licensed casinos must supply a mandatory deposit limit upon signup, while KGC-regulated sites are required to provide links to problem gambling helplines and allow players to set session time limits. When evaluating a casino, take the time to explore the footer of the website—often the licence and security information is posted there. If it is missing or vague, that is a red flag. In summary, the first step in any casino review is to verify that the operator holds a valid licence from a recognised Canadian or provincial authorisation, uses robust encryption, and submits to regular independent audits. Without these basics, no amount of attractive bonuses or game selection variety can create up for the increased risk to your funds and personal data. Always prioritize licensing and security above all other factors when building trust with an online casino. Additionally, players should be aware of the distinction between provinces: while Ontario has its own regulated iGaming market since April 2022, other provinces ilk British Columbia (via BCLC) and Quebec (via Loto-Québec) operate their own online platforms or partner with licensed operators. Some offshore casinos also hold up licences from the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), which are recognised internationally but may not offer the same consumer protections as Canadian provincial regulators. It is advisable to confirm that the casino accepts Canadian dollars and offers divine service team in English or French. Also, check for a seclusion policy that explains how personal data is collected, stored, and shared—a reputable casino will never sell your information without consent.
